Message Content. Any email sent by an Affiliate that promotes Tori Belle Cosmetics, the Tori Belle opportunity, or products and services, it must comply with the following: • There must be a functioning return email address to the sender. • There must be a notice in the email that advises the recipient that they may reply to the email, via the functioning return email address, to request that future email solicitations or correspondence not be sent to them (i.e., a functioning “opt-out” notice). • The email must clearly and conspicuously disclose that the message is an advertisement or solicitation. • The use of deceptive subject lines and/or false header information is prohibited. • All opt-out requests, whether received by email or regular mail, must be honored immediately, and in no case in more than 10 business days. • The message must clearly identify the Affiliate by name and state that the message is from that Affiliate, not from the Tori Belle Cosmetics, LLC. corporate office. The Company may periodically send commercial emails on behalf of Affiliates. By entering into the Independent Sale Agreement, an Affiliate agrees that the Company may send such emails and that the Affiliate’s email addresses will be included in such emails as outlined above. Affiliates shall honor opt-out requests generated as a result of such emails sent by the Company or otherwise provided to Affiliate by the Company in accordance with the above requirements.
